President Bola Ahmed Tinubu will on Friday, September 19, embark on a working visit to Kaduna State as part of his engagements in the North-West.
According to a statement by his Special Adviser on Information and Strategy, Bayo Onanuga, the President is expected to attend the wedding ceremony of Nasirudeen Yari and Safiyya Shehu Idris. The groom, Nasirudeen, is the son of Senator Abdul’aziz Yari, who represents Zamfara West Senatorial District and a former governor of Zamfara State.
While in Kaduna, President Tinubu will also pay a courtesy visit to Aisha Buhari, widow of the late former President Muhammadu Buhari, at the family residence. The visit, observers say, underscores the President’s continued respect for the Buhari family and his commitment to maintaining close ties with past leaders of the country.
The trip, though brief, highlights the President’s effort to combine state duties with personal and political engagements across the country. He is expected to return to Abuja later on Friday after completing the scheduled activities.
